Euphorbia tithymaloides, also known as "Devil's Backbone," is an unusual houseplant appreciated for the unique shape of its stems and its decorative foliage. Its upright, zig-zagging stems bear oval, shiny, fleshy leaves of a vibrant green, sometimes edged with red or tinged with pink depending on light exposure. This zig-zag growth gives it a unique, graphic appearance that immediately catches the eye. Under good conditions, the plant can reach 60 to 100 cm in height, forming a compact, branched shrub.

Caution, handle with care! The sap, which contains latex, can cause irritation upon contact with skin and eyes. Risk of toxicity if ingested.

  • Family: Euphorbiaceae.
  • Origin: Tropical and subtropical America.
  • Watering:
    • Spring - Summer: Allow half of the potting soil to dry out between waterings.
    • Fall - Winter: Allow the potting soil to dry out completely between waterings.
  • Ambient humidity: Low to moderate.
  • Potting soil type: Dry and well-draining.
    • Avoid letting water sit in the saucer.
  • Light: Moderate to High.
    • Orientation: West, East, or 1 m from a South-facing window.
  • Growth: Fast.
  • Temperature: Average, maintain around 20ᵒC.
